首页 > 电脑 > Kubernetes有哪些组件?这些组件分别是什么功能?

Kubernetes有哪些组件?这些组件分别是什么功能?

电脑 2022-06-28

kubernetes 提供什么功能

Kubernetes,是开源容器应用自动化部署技术,也就是大家经常说的k8s。

Kubernetes(k8s)是自动化容器操作的开源平台,这些操作包括部署,调度和节点集群间扩展。如果你曾经用过Docker容器技术部署容器,那么可以将Docker看成Kubernetes内部使用的低级别组件。Kubernetes不仅仅支持Docker,还支持Rocket,这是另一种容器技术。

使用Kubernetes可以:

  • 自动化容器的部署和复制

  • 随时扩展或收缩容器规模

  • 将容器组织成组,并且提供容器间的负载均衡

  • 很容易地升级应用程序容器的新版本

  • 提供容器弹性,如果容器失效就替换它,等等...

它有这些特点:

  • 可移植:支持公有云,私有云,混合云,多重云 multi-cloud

  • 可扩展:模块化,插件化,可挂载,可组合

  • 自动化:自动部署,自动重启,自动复制,自动伸缩/扩展

如果还有想要了解的可以到官网或是相关教程视频中看看,比如B站这个视频教程:

初级Kubernetes技术如何学习?

一、初级 1. 了解Kubernetes 基础架构与核心组件功能 2. 了解Docker基本概念和用法 3. 理解Docker与Kubernetes的基本关系 4. 能够安装、部署与配置 Kubernetes 集群 5. 熟练使用 kubectl 命令操作各种 Kubernetes 资源对象,了解基本概念和使用方法 6. 能够在 Kubernetes 上部署、运行、管理工作负载并了解其调度算法 7. 能够使用 Service、Ingress 等访问工作负载 8. 深入理解Pod相关的配置及使用 9. 了解Kubernetes生态相关工具及其作用 二、中级 1. 理解Kubernetes的资源管

如何学习,了解kubernetes

首先,你先要知道什么是Kubernetes,Kubernetes又简称K8S,其中8是代表中间“ubernete”的8个字符。

K8S是自动化容器操作的开源平台,这些操作包括部署,调度和节点集群间扩展。如果你曾经用过Docker容器技术部署容器,那么可以将Docker看成Kubernetes内部使用的低级别组件。Kubernetes不仅仅支持Docker,还支持Rocket,这是另一种容器技术。这项技术本身是偏向运维方向,是运维必须要学习和掌握的一个技术。但开发人员平时开发后可能要测试部署时也会用到Kubernetes,所以需要咱们开发人员认真学习!

使用Kubernetes可以:

  • 自动化容器的部署和复制

  • 随时扩展或收缩容器规模

  • 将容器组织成组,并且提供容器间的负载均衡

  • 很容易地升级应用程序容器的新版本

  • 提供容器弹性,如果容器失效就替换它,等等...

提醒K8s学习有一个前提条件,需要先掌握docker,如果你没有docker基础的话,那还不能学习 K8s k8s它底层的部署容器的那么容器本来就是docker。

也可以自己先在网上(B站)看视频了解一下相关内容:

Kubernetes为什么那么重要

Kubernetes(k8s)是自动化容器操作的开源平台,这些操作包括部署,调度和节点集群间扩展。如果你曾经用过Docker容器技术部署容器,那么可以将Docker看成Kubernetes内部使用的低级别组件。Kubernetes不仅仅支持Docker,还支持Rocket,这是另一种容器技术。

使用Kubernetes可以:

  • 自动化容器的部署和复制

  • 随时扩展或收缩容器规模

  • 将容器组织成组,并且提供容器间的负载均衡

  • 很容易地升级应用程序容器的新版本

  • 提供容器弹性,如果容器失效就替换它,等等...

想了解更多Kubernetes更多知识可以在网上找找教程视频,下面这个就很不错。


Kubernetes技术人员有什么发展?

一、初级 10. 了解Kubernetes 基础架构与核心组件功能 11. 了解Docker基本概念和用法 12. 理解Docker与Kubernetes的基本关系 13. 能够安装、部署与配置 Kubernetes 集群 14. 熟练使用 kubectl 命令操作各种 Kubernetes 资源对象,了解基本概念和使用方法 15. 能够在 Kubernetes 上部署、运行、管理工作负载并了解其调度算法 16. 能够使用 Service、Ingress 等访问工作负载 17. 深入理解Pod相关的配置及使用 18. 了解Kubernetes生态相关工具及其作用 二、中级 12. 理解Kube

标签:信息技术 工具 互联网 学习 电脑

大明白知识网 Copyright © 2020-2022 www.wangpan131.com. Some Rights Reserved.